what are the impacts of covid-19 on the productivity of Walmart and how does they overcome the supply and sales issues?
As coronavirus pandemic spread across the U.S. so companies including Walmart are navigating productivity from sick as well as health workers and also allow them to work remotely from home. During the COVID-19 crisis, Walmart has been continuously making changes so to support it's staff effectively. Walmart and other large companies can still maintain the sales volume through e-commerce but as the workforce is operating remotely, so the company may face short-term productivity hit as employees are working from their home. Despite the impact on productivity, employees need to focus on goods deliverables.
One of the centers for Walmart's supply chain strategy is cross-docking which helps to replenish the inventory effectively. As the company uses a global sourcing structure to purchase goods all over the world, it is facing some difficulties now. In order to cope up with the crisis situation, the company has started using an alternative source such as the farmers and vendors who have never worked with the company before. They have chosen the suppliers without compromising the quality standards of the company. Walmart is also working closely with the government to overcome transportation challenges.
